Output d9194b52110785622a6ffc93ceb8b2b68d4d3bbf624ece5dd4e1d80c9d3abf54:8

value
514497
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ab05a4dbbe254913873393c7a1b14bda5658c05 OP_EQUAL
address
32fXwfaA89woNsnWvgqatsqiimpNmzMsqR
transaction
d9194b52110785622a6ffc93ceb8b2b68d4d3bbf624ece5dd4e1d80c9d3abf54
confirmations
276728
spent
true